Although the K12LTSP desktop has a wealth of choices and applications, 
there are too many for our sixth grade class. Since my knowledge of Linux 
is limited (but growing), it is too easy for students to activate 
applications that they (and I) are unfamiliar with.

All we really need at this point is Open Office and a few games. We can add 
more applications back later as our skill level grows. I don't want their 
choices to get ahead of their training.

How can I limit the users choices without having to access each users desktop.

How can I customize the desktop and menu choices in one place and have it 
propagate to all the users?
